Europe is currently grappling with a severe heatwave that has pushed temperatures to dangerously high levels, underscoring the urgent need for robust action against climate change. This extreme weather event serves as a clear warning of the escalating risks posed by global warming.
Challenges to Climate Goals
Despite the pressing situation, some political factions, particularly from the populist right, have been critical of the net zero targets. They argue that these goals are either unrealistic or potentially harmful to the economy. However, the current heatwave highlights why such ambitious targets are essential.
The Importance of Ambitious Climate Action
An editorial from The Guardian stresses that European leaders must seize this moment to educate the public on the critical importance of reducing carbon emissions. Without meeting net zero commitments, Europe risks facing more frequent and intense heatwaves, which could lead to significant health, environmental, and economic consequences.
Path Forward for Europe
To mitigate future climate risks, Europe must focus on:
- Expanding sustainable energy sources
- Implementing stronger climate policies
- Reinforcing commitments to the Paris Agreement
- Promoting global sustainability efforts
The decisions made today will have profound effects on future generations, making it crucial for governments to act decisively now.
